View the recommendation results

Display the recommended cooling regions and inspect the plastic temperature to identify where cooling is most needed.

  1. Click Results to open the results page.
  2. In the Results panel, from the Type list, make sure Recommendation is selected.
    Recommended cooling regions are shown and color-coded by priority.

  3. Rotate the model to inspect the recommendation results inside the plastic part.
  4. On the Results panel, turn on the Filter toggle.
  5. Move the Filter slider to Critical to filter the display to focus on critical areas.

  6. On the Results panel, move the Filter slider back to Moderate to reset the recommendation view.
  7. On the Results panel, turn on the Cutting Plane and Invert toggles.
  8. Move the Cutting Plane slider to examine interior regions.

  9. From the Type list, select Temperature and move the Cutting Plane slider to view the temperature distribution.

  10. On the Results panel, turn off the Cutting Plane toggle, turn on the Filter toggle, and move the left handle of the slider to 110°C.
    The software displays areas within the selected temperature range. This helps you identify regions that require longer cooling to reach the target temperature.
